Safety

Bunk beds are a great option to free up space in kids bedrooms, but they can pose a safety hazard if not properly assembled and maintained. Make sure that your bunk bed is equipped with an sturdy ladder, safety rails, and the right mattress foundation for the height and age of your children. Make sure your children are careful when climbing up and down the top bunk, and to avoid rough play that could weaken or damage the structure.

Most bunk bed-related injuries occur in children younger than six years old, possibly because they lack the coordination to be able to safely sleep on the top bunk, and also climb down the ladder without falling. This is why bunk beds should only be used by children who are over the age of six and no child under the age of six should be sleeping on the top bunk.

If your kids are going to be sleeping on the top bunk, be sure that there are full length guard rails that extend at least 5 inches higher than the mattress's surface. Also, make sure that there are no gaps or holes in the upper bunk's guardrails, ladders or mattress foundations that your kids head, limbs or bodies can traverse. Insert a wedge into the openings or spaces and pull it gently and with a steady pressure.

Be sure your children don't hang their clothes, toys or any other items from the top bunk beds for kids or the ladder. These items could cause dangerous tripping hazards that could cause strangulation and falls. Encourage your children to take off any tripping hazards prior to bedtime. Remind your children to take the same precautions for guests when they are having an overnight stay.

Don't let your children jump or roughhouse the ladder or bunks. This can cause them fall or get trapped beneath the bunk. Also, make sure that only one child is sleeping on the top bunk at a time, as a child's jumping or rough playing can cause the mattress foundation to collapse and possibly crush the child.

Stability

A bunk bed is a unit containing two beds stacked one above the other. It's a great method to maximize the space of a small space. Bunk beds are available in a variety of styles that can be adapted to any style. Available in wood or steel, they can be designed to look traditional or modern. Some models include storage underneath the bottom bunk. This can be an easy way to store clothes, toys and other items.

A top-quality double bunk bed should have strong guard rails, as well as a ladder that is strong enough to hold both children and adults. The ladder must have an elongated frame and non-slip steps. It should be at a minimum of fifteen inches (based on US regulations) above the mattress's surface to stop children from tangling themselves.

Another important safety aspect is to make sure that the slats supporting the mattress are evenly spaced and not more than 4 inches apart. This will stop the limbs from being stuck between the slats or falling through them which could cause serious injury. Bunk beds must be assembled correctly according to the instructions of the manufacturer, and should undergo regular maintenance and inspections.

In addition to these safety measures In addition, you need to teach your children how to use the bunk bed safely. They should never jump onto the top bunk, and only one child should sleep there at any one time. You should also remind them not to use the upper bunk as a play area and to avoid climbing onto or hanging from the framework.

A twin over full bunk bed is a fantastic option for siblings that are close in age, and some models even have the possibility of adding an additional full-size mattress underneath the bottom bunk. This is an excellent solution for families who often have guests staying over or who require extra space for children at home.
